This is a **combination drug** containing three active ingredients commonly used to treat symptoms associated with cough, upper respiratory congestion, and bronchospasm: - **Guaifenesin** is an expectorant that helps thin and loosen mucus in the airways, making it easier to clear from the respiratory tract. - **Doxylamine succinate** is a first-generation antihistamine with anticholinergic and sedative properties, often used to reduce symptoms such as runny nose and sneezing associated with upper respiratory tract infections. - **Etafedrine hydrochloride** is a sympathomimetic agent and selective beta-2 adrenoceptor agonist, structurally related to ephedrine, which acts as a bronchodilator and has decongestant activity, thereby relieving bronchospasm and nasal congestion. This combination is not widely marketed under a single well-known brand name and appears in the medical literature for treatment of respiratory conditions such as chronic bronchitis, and bronchospasm, and may also be used for cough and cold symptoms. It is formulated as an **oral pharmaceutical** and is typically used for symptomatic respiratory relief in conditions involving cough, mucus hypersecretion, or bronchospasm[1][7].
